Original Description
Geoffrey Douglas Giles’ "St Windeline & Wool Winder" unfolds a serene pastoral scene imbued with quiet spirituality and rustic charm. This late 19th-century painting, anchored in the Pre-Raphaelite tradition, showcases intricate botanical details and luminous colors—signature traits of Giles’ devotion to naturalism and medieval romanticism. St Windeline, draped in ethereal fabrics, tenderly interacts with her wool-winding companion amidst a sun-dappled meadow, evoking themes of purity and harmony with nature. Though lesser-known compared to Rossetti or Burne-Jones, Giles’ works occupy a niche in British Victorian art, celebrated for their delicate lyricism and revival of Gothic sentimentalism. Meanwhile, "Queen of the Spring & Gesomina" exudes theatrical exuberance, depicting floral-garlanded figures reminiscent of Botticelli’s Primavera. Its jewel-toned palette and flowing drapery reflect the Aesthetic Movement’s "art for art’s sake" ethos, positioning it as a bridge between Pre-Raphaelitism and Art Nouveau.
